How they compare
Togo currently reports 711,617 against 671,064 in Lao People’s Democratic Republic, a difference of 40,553.
That makes Togo's figure about 1.1 times Lao People’s Democratic Republic's.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 43 shared years of data; in 1971 it was Togo ahead.
Lao People’s Democratic Republic ranks 81st and Togo ranks 78th of 204 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Lao People’s Democratic Republic averaged higher in 3 and Togo in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Lao People’s Democratic Republic | Togo |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 33,247 | 57,224 | 23,977 | Togo |
| 1980s | 88,707 | 107,820 | 19,113 | Togo |
| 1990s | 161,663 | 151,534 | 10,129 | Lao People’s Democratic Republic |
| 2000s | 359,417 | 350,347 | 9,070 | Lao People’s Democratic Republic |
| 2010s | 577,471 | 572,462 | 5,009 | Lao People’s Democratic Republic |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Secondary general pupils are the number of secondary students enrolled in general education programs, including teacher training.
